raphael js 中set 的妙用

本文介绍了一种在开发过程中批量为多张图片设置相同属性的方法,通过创建一个集合并将所有图片加入该集合,随后统一设置属性,以此减少重复代码并简化操作。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

本人在开发中,为了实现拖拽功能,需要引入多幅图片,且这些图片sttr 即属性都相同。

一开始,本人引入了多幅图片,并在每幅图片后面添加sttr:

.attr({

stroke: "none",
opacity: 1,
cursor:"pointer"
});

这样的操作相当繁琐,并且有一大堆重复代码。

解决方法:

建立一个 set()

将所有的图片push到set中

pictureset.push(picture1,picture2,picture3,picture4,picture5,picture6);

set 后添加.attr

pictureset.attr({

stroke: "none",
opacity: 1,
cursor:"pointer"
});

经过测试,两者的功能相同

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值